Formerly one of the largest and most prosperous cities of medieval Europe, Rouen is located in Normandy along the River Seine in northern France.  The French reclaimed terra cotta brick paver we salvaged from a former blacksmith shop reveals the story of fire and earth forged into a flamed-licked red where burnt black marks play heavily into this story.  One can imagine the brick pavers holding space behind the weight of forged hot iron molding steel.  Its surface texture - coarse and smooth is rugged and strong - perhaps like the blacksmith himself.  Various clay red colors weave themselves around burnt black markings - that have inscribed their forever story onto this handmade antique brick paver.  A perfect companion is to marry this historic cool red + black terra cotta brick with the softness and warmth of rich aged oak, found in our Kings of France 18th Century French Oak Floors - The Olde Oak Collection: Sussex.  The contrast of rough + smooth; cool + warm is always the equation for natural beauty that will forever be authentic in one's home.

Recommended Sealer after Installation:  Akemi Stone Impregnation for French Reclaimed Terra Cotta Tile Flooring 

Cleaning and Maintenance:  This lot will need surface cleaning after installation. Vacuum, then clean with Black Soap (Savon Noir) to disinfect, maintain, protect and enhance patina.
